Historical Overview

Storming of the neutral city by the French; surrender of Blücher.

Quick Facts

Outcome:French victory.

Grande Armée

  • Commander: Murat / Bernadotte
  • Strength: ca. 35.000
  • Casualties: ca. 1.000

Kingdom of Prussia

  • Commander: Gebhard v. Blücher
  • Strength: ca. 20.000
  • Casualties: ca. 20.000 (Gefangen)

Strategic Context

Pursuit of the last Prussian remnants to the Baltic Sea.
